The British Council ISPF Early Career Fellowship (Brazil), supported by the UK’s International Science Partnerships Fund (ISPF) and sponsored by the British Council, invites excellent academics from Brazil to attend the University of Bradford for a fully funded 12-month fellowship focused on engineering and digital technologies. The Faculty of Engineering & Digital Technologies offers an intriguing combination of basic engineering disciplines and creative technologies that complement one another, resulting in new solutions with significant sector impact.

The University of Bradford is a public research institution based in England that obtained its royal charter in 1966, making it the 40th university in the United Kingdom. British Council ISPF Early Career Fellowship 2026 Details:

Offered by:British Council
Fellowship coverage:Funded
Eligible nationality:Brazilians
Award country:United Kingdom
Last Date:15 August 2025

Financial Benefits:

  • Tax-free stipend of £35,000 during the whole 12-month program.
  • Return economy airfare from Brazil to the UK.
  • Visa and NHS surcharge charges are reimbursed.
  • Research expenses budget (for consumables, travel, and sustenance)
  • Extra allowance for dependents
  • Desk space and access to campus services such as the fitness center, physiotherapy, counseling, and lunch places.
  • Family-friendly assistance and community involvement possibilities.

Fellowship Themes:

You will do groundbreaking research in one of the following focus areas.

Research Area 1: Conservation

Concentrate on sustainable engineering materials, waste-to-resource conversion, and circular economy principles.

Research Area 2: Traditional Communities

Discover knowledge systems, biodiversity conservation, climate adaptation, cultural heritage, and language revitalization in traditional and Indigenous communities.

Research Area 3: Public Health

Explore Amazonian health systems, tropical diseases, cultural health frameworks, and accessibility issues.

Eligibility Criteria:

To be considered for the British Council ISPF Early Career Fellowship 2026 in the UK, international students must meet the following eligibility criteria:

  • You must be a permanent resident in Brazil.
  • Applicants must be associated with Amazon/Amazônia Legal universities or research centers.
  • Be an early career researcher (PhD recently completed or approaching completion; not in a permanent academic job).
  • Candidates must have a first degree in science, computing, or engineering.
  • Applicants must show a background or interest in one of the research areas.
  • Fulfill the UK visa and English language eligibility requirements.
  • Candidates must not receive funding from any other UK source or be a member of a for-profit organization

Application Deadline:

The last date to apply for the British Council ISPF Early Career Fellowship 2026 in the UK for international students is 15th August 2025.

How to Apply for British Council ISPF Early Career Fellowship?

  1. Use the online application process to submit an admissions application.
  2. Go to the scholarship application and fill it out in accordance with the guidelines.
  3. Compile and turn in the necessary documentation.
  4. Shortlisted candidates will be called for interviews by October 31, 2025, with final fellowship offers made by November 30, 2025.
  5. Successful applicants are scheduled to arrive in the UK between January and February 2026, with the fellowship officially beginning in February to March 2026.
  6. The fellowship will end a year later, between February and March 2027.
